ICD-9-CMThis code signifies hyperbilirubinemia in a newborn specifically attributed to prematurity. It indicates a physiological jaundice that is more pronounced or prolonged due to the immature hepatic function common in preterm infants.
Apply this code when documentation clearly states neonatal jaundice and explicitly links it to the infant's preterm birth. This is often seen in premature infants requiring phototherapy or other interventions for elevated bilirubin levels.
